Total Company: 8458
Location South Delhi, Delhi, India
Hospitality & Wellness Tourism And Accommodation
Urban Palette Restaurants Llp is engaged in the business of hotels, motels, restaurants, resorts, entertainment complexes, cafe, multiplexes and other related businesses in India and abroad.